Delaware regulator flags carriers potentially stretching step therapy exceptions to biologics

Share

On March 24, 2026, the Delaware Department of Insurance issued Domestic and Foreign Insurers Bulletin No. 165, signed by Commissioner Trinidad Navarro and directed at all insurers, health service corporations, and managed care organizations that deliver or issue individual and group insurance policies or plans subject to regulation under Title 18 of the Delaware Code. The Department said it had reviewed carrier practices and found that clarification was needed to ensure uniform and accurate implementation of the state’s step therapy provisions.
